As nouns, Leontodon autumnalis is a hyponym of hawkbit; that is, Leontodon autumnalis is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than hawkbit:
  • hawkbit: any of various common wildflowers of the genus Leontodon; of temperate Eurasia to Mediterranean regions
  • Leontodon autumnalis: fall-blooming European herb with a yellow flower; naturalized in the United States
Other hyponyms of hawkbit include arnica bud, fall dandelion.
